I feel for this situation. It's certainly a difficult place to be in, but, being put across that way, it sounds like there's still some hope. Being put in a holding pool is somewhat better than being dumped altogether, as was the case with other carriers. easyJet didn't let go of your son completely, they just postponed his final bit of training and employment till better days, as I understood.

What I would suggest for now is wait for the dust to settle. In the next months we'll have a far clearer picture of what we're dealing with - hence, both the company and the flight school will know better what to plan on. Do maintain some communication with whomever is listed as your point of contact - that's what will help you decide whether you should keep that licence and wait it out or convert it to an ATPL and try to find luck elsewhere. Perhaps either of these is not going to be a quick fix, but for now we know too little to decide firmly on anything.
